Genus of flowering plants
Heteropsis is a
genus of plants in the
family
Araceae , native to
Central and
South America .

Species
Heteropsis boliviana
Rusby - Bolivia
Heteropsis croatii M.L.Soares - Peru, northwestern Brazil
Heteropsis duckeana M.L.Soares - northwestern Brazil
Heteropsis ecuadorensis
Sodiro - Ecuador
Heteropsis flexuosa (
Kunth )
G.S.Bunting - Colombia, Venezuela, the Guianas, Ecuador, Peru, Bolivia, northwestern Brazil
Heteropsis linearis
A.C.Sm. - Peru, northwestern Brazil
Heteropsis longispathacea
Engl. - northwestern Brazil
Heteropsis macrophylla
A.C.Sm. - Amazonas State of northwestern Brazil
Heteropsis melinonii (
Engl. )
A.M.E.Jonker & Jonker - Venezuela, the Guianas
Heteropsis oblongifolia
Kunth - Central America, Colombia, Peru, Bolivia, Brazil
Heteropsis peruviana
K.Krause - Ecuador, Peru, Bolivia, northwestern Brazil
Heteropsis rigidifolia
Engl. - southeastern Brazil
Heteropsis robusta (G.S.Bunting) M.L.Soares - Colombia, Venezuela, Peru, Ecuador, northwestern Brazil
Heteropsis salicifolia
Kunth - eastern Brazil
Heteropsis spruceana
Schott - Colombia, Venezuela, the Guianas, Ecuador, northwestern Brazil
Heteropsis steyermarkii
G.S.Bunting - Colombia, Venezuela, French Guinea, Peru, northwestern Brazil
Heteropsis tenuispadix
G.S.Bunting - Colombia, Venezuela, the Guianas, Peru, Bolivia, northwestern Brazil
